Although nurses across generations have called for nursing practice to be informed by the best evidence available in the moment, evidencebased practice has gained prominence across healthcare since release of the 2001 institute of medicines report crossing the quality chasm. Evidence based practice introduction evidencebased practice ebp is a problemsolving approach to the delivery of health care that integrates the best evidence from studies and patient care data with clinician expertise and patient preferences and values. Evidence based clinical practice in nursing and healthcare examines the joanna briggs institute model for evidence based practice which recognises research, theory and practice as sources of evidence and takes a practical approach to developing, implementing and evaluating practice, based on evidence in its broadest sense.
